Top 8 Lakes around Bandelin

Best lakes around Bandelin are found in a region characterized by rolling hills, meadows, fields, and dense forests, located in the Vorpommern-Greifswald district of Mecklenburg-Vorpommern, Germany. While Bandelin itself does not feature large, well-known lakes directly within its immediate vicinity, the area offers diverse water features. The municipality's area extends westward to the Peene River, known for canoeing and fishing. The Söllkensee near Potthagen is a natural monument, notable for its ecological processes and wildlife observation.

The Söllkensee was created in the 19th century by peat extraction in "Küsterbäcks Moor", a meltwater channel of the Greifswald terminal moraine. Today it is a natural monument and spawning ground for common toads and moor frogs. In the north-eastern part, the new siltation process is clearly visible. A cotton grass peat bog has formed here, which is partly forested with downy birches.

Frequently Asked Questions

What unique natural features can I explore around Bandelin?

The region around Bandelin offers diverse water features. You can explore the Söllkensee near Potthagen, a natural monument formed by peat extraction, which serves as a spawning ground for common toads and moor frogs. Its ongoing siltation process has created a unique cotton grass peat bog. Additionally, the Peene River, known as the 'Amazon of the North,' offers beautiful canoeing routes and opportunities for fishing.

Are there family-friendly lakes or activities near Bandelin?

Yes, several spots are suitable for families. The Kosenowsee Loop Trail is family-friendly, featuring many resting places and a lido for cooling off in summer. The Völschow village pond is a well-kept spot with water lilies, perfect for a relaxing break. The Jarmen Gravel Pit Lake also has a beach and is considered family-friendly.

Can I swim in any of the lakes near Bandelin?

Yes, for swimming, the Kosenowsee Loop Trail features a lido that invites visitors to cool off in summer. The Jarmen Gravel Pit Lake also has a beach suitable for swimming. However, the smaller Söllkensee, while beautiful for resting, is not really suitable for swimming.

What is the best time of year to visit the lakes around Bandelin?

The lakes around Bandelin offer different attractions depending on the season. Spring is ideal for nature enthusiasts to observe blue moor frogs at the Söllkensee near Potthagen. Summer is perfect for cooling off at the lido on the Kosenowsee Loop Trail or enjoying the beach at the Jarmen Gravel Pit Lake.

What kind of lakes are found in the Bandelin region?

The Bandelin region features a variety of water bodies, including natural lakes, village ponds, and gravel pit lakes. Examples include the ecologically significant Söllkensee near Potthagen, the well-kept Völschow village pond, and the artificially created Jarmen Gravel Pit Lake, which originated from industrial gravel mining.
